Title: How to "run in" GTi DSG?
Post by: Eric Shun on 20 July 2005, 15:45
When I finally get my car (-August?), what is the best advice about "running in"?


 :rolleyes:
Title: Re: How to "run in" GTi DSG?
Post by: Agreeable Slick on 20 July 2005, 15:49
same way as would any other engine i guess, no thrashing for the first 1000-1200 miles, work up through the revs, not going above 3k for the first 6-700 miles. Gently accellerating, no foot to the floor business. Oh and a oil change once you have done it.  :smiley:
